What’s the Deal with the Strategy Tab?

So, you might wonder, "What exactly makes the Strategy Tab so important?" Well, this tab is not just another cog in the wheel; it’s the engine driving your decision-making process. With it, users can define and tweak the many components of their next best offer strategy, including the rules and metrics that shape how those offers come to life.

Here’s the thing: in today’s fast-paced market, providing personalized offers isn't just a nice-to-have; it’s a game-changer. Consumers expect offers that resonate with their needs, and the Strategy Tab is where that personalization begins.

Breaking It Down

When you enter the Strategy Tab, it feels like walking into a workshop full of possibilities. From here, you can incorporate elements like decision trees, conditions, and filters that help shape the generated offers. Think of decision trees as the branching paths of a maze; they help you choose the right approach based on specific criteria. Each path can lead to unique offers tailored to individual customer journeys.

And remember, the magic of the Strategy Tab lies in its customization. You have the power to ensure that your decisioning strategy aligns well with both your business goals and your customers' expectations. So, whether you’re aiming for retention, upselling, or something entirely different, the Strategy Tab enables you to craft the logical flow that meets your objectives.

The Importance of Real-Time Decisioning

In case you didn't know, one of the exciting aspects of modern decision-making platforms is real-time decisioning capabilities. This means not only can you personalize offers based on historical data, but you can also adapt to new data as it pours in. It’s like being in a restaurant where the menu changes based on what’s fresh at the market that day!

With the Strategy Tab, you can set up real-time conditions that adjust offers on-the-fly, responding to customer interactions. Perhaps a customer just explored a certain product but didn’t opt to purchase; that’s a golden opportunity to offer a discount or a complimentary product via the next best offer strategy. It’s all about being agile and relevant!
